The Rise of Online Gambling Scams
The rapid increase of online casinos has unfortunately been accompanied by a rise in scams. Fraudsters are becoming increasingly sophisticated in their methods, often creating websites that mimic reputable casinos. These counterfeit sites lure unsuspecting players with attractive bonuses and promotions, only to disappear with their money.
Online scams can take many forms, including phishing attacks, fake apps, and manipulative advertising. These tactics often exploit the excitement players feel when they engage in gambling activities. As a result, it is crucial to stay vigilant and conduct thorough research before committing to any online gambling site.
Identifying the Warning Signs
To protect oneself from falling victim to casino scams, it’s important to know the warning signs. Here are some key indicators to watch for:
- Lack of Regulation: Always ensure that the casino is licensed and regulated by a reputable authority. A legitimate casino will have this information readily available.
- Poor Website Design: Scammers often invest little in creating a professional-looking website. Typos, broken links, and outdated information can be red flags.
- Unrealistic Bonuses: If an offer seems too good to be true, it probably is. Be cautious of sites offering huge bonuses without any proper terms and conditions.
- Unresponsive Customer Service: Genuine casinos prioritize customer support. If their contact information seems sketchy or responses are slow, you might want to steer clear.
Common Casino Scams to Avoid
Understanding the types of scams prevalent in the gambling industry can help players avoid losing their hard-earned money. Here are some common scams to be aware of:
Phishing Scams
Phishing scams involve con artists attempting to steal personal information by pretending to be legitimate casinos. These scams often take place via email or fake websites. Players may receive emails that appear to be from their favorite casino, asking them to verify account details or download malicious software.
Fake Apps
With the rise of mobile gambling, scammers have developed fake poker or casino apps that promise big wins. These apps often collect sensitive information or simply take your money without providing any gaming experience in return.
Payment Scams
Be wary of casinos that insist on using unconventional payment methods or those that offer limited withdrawal options. A legitimate casino will provide several secure payment methods and allow players to withdraw their winnings easily and transparently.
